Built a 2.5 mm wick from 500 mesh, 37 mm X 65mm as i wanted to try that out...the coil is a 0.66 build, and apart from a nasty dry hit early on, even after wetting the wick...tried it too quickly, didn't let the wick do its job.
I watches several videos on these rta's and they said to fill the wick hope completely, but Vaslovik said she uses a 2.5mm wick so there is a little space round it...and that made sense to me, as i never usually completely fill the wick hole when i use mesh. Built the coil at 2.5mm and inserted the wick. Not even a trace of dry hit now.
Certainly lets the air flow a whole lot better, and is running superbly now at 26.7 watts or 4.2 volts. This coil is absolutely stable as well, whereas the first try the ohms was wandering a little and not working too great! Working excellently on my Calvert 18350 mod also!
